Equation of a circle in standard form:
(x-h)²+(y-k)²=r²
r=radius
(h,k) is the center.
In this case:
(h,k) =(0,0) (h=0,k=0 )
r=4
Therefore:
(x-0)²+(y-0)²=4²
x²+y²=16
Answer: x²+y²=16
